Home / Edi­tions / Bari 2011

Bari 2011

I Edi­tion . 25–27 novem­ber
This was the first edi­tion of MEDIMEX. It took place at Fiera del Levante, from 25 to 27 Novem­ber 2011. Puglia Sounds, the region­al pro­gramme for the devel­op­ment of the Puglia music sys­tem, had been launched just the year before. Med­imex, the Medi­ter­ranean Music Expo, is an oppor­tun­ity to wel­come to Bari, meet and pro­mote part­ner­ships between music oper­at­ors from Puglia and those com­ing from oth­er Itali­an regions and from abroad.

Med­imex was foun­ded as a music fair, the only one in Italy ded­ic­ated to all genres of music. Three days of artist­ic and com­mer­cial exchange as well as Meet the Author gath­er­ings, con­fer­ences and them­at­ic meet­ings, but also speed dat­ing, show­cases and events. The aim is to bring togeth­er the prot­ag­on­ists of the inter­na­tion­al music industry to dis­cuss the pro­spects, prob­lems and oppor­tun­it­ies of the Itali­an and Medi­ter­ranean mar­kets.

One thou­sand three hun­dred oper­at­ors, two hun­dred artists, over two hun­dred journ­al­ists, twenty-one guest coun­tries and five thou­sand vis­it­ors in an area of eight thou­sand square meters with one hun­dred and fifty booths and fifty live events includ­ing show­cases and events, thirty con­fer­ences, meet­ings and speed dat­ing, in addi­tion to host­ing the fif­teenth edi­tion of MEI, the Meet­ing of Inde­pend­ent Labels: this is the first edi­tion in num­bers.

The open­ing event of the first edi­tion, on Novem­ber 24, 2011, was Merav­iglioso Mod­ugno, at the Pet­ruzzelli Theatre in Bari, a trib­ute to Domen­ico Mod­ugno pro­duced in col­lab­or­a­tion with the Pre­mio Tenco and fea­tur­ing Vini­cio Capos­sela and the Mari­netti sis­ters, Simone Crist­ic­chi, Cristina Donà, Mauro Erman­no Giovanardi, Pino Marino, Nada & Fausto Mesolella, Roy Paci, Radi­oder­vish, Peppe Servillo, Daniele Sil­vestri, Sud Sound Sys­tem, Paola Turci and Peppe Vol­tarelli. A trib­ute to the most fam­ous songs and to the invalu­able per­form­ances in ver­nacu­lar lan­guage of the pro­duc­tion of Domen­ico Mod­ugno, an artist who intro­duced in his songs the “inven­tion of the sea” and the “bit­ter­ness of his land”, in the same theat­er where fifty years earli­er Mod­ugno had cel­eb­rated the 100th anniversary of the Uni­fic­a­tion of Italy with “Rinaldo in Campo”.

From reg­gae to pop­u­lar music, from the sounds of the Balkans to exper­i­ment­al music, from elec­tron­ic music to rock music: twenty-one artists, from Puglia, Italy and oth­er coun­tries, took turns on three stages for a jour­ney through the sounds of the Medi­ter­ranean. Sav­ina Yan­natou, The Ban­diti, Bianco, Roberta Alloisio, Sonia Brex, Boom Da Bash, Fab­riz­io Cam­marata flanked by Second Grace, Moussu T and Lei Jovents, Rodrigo Leao flanked by Cinema Ensemble, Badi­aa Bouhr­izi, Djmawi Africa, Trans­g­lob­al Under­ground and Natacha Atlas.
